We catch up with designer, pattern-cutter and dressmaker Lynsey about her latest looks, perfect for intimate weddings. Firstly, she unveils her Ziggy metallic jumpsuit teamed with the Stardust tulle overskirt, perfect for fashion-forward brides who feel that a traditional white gown would look too formal for their micro wedding. “It's a fun look without compromising on style,” Lynsey says. Stella , a silver silk-satin and star-embellished tulle bridal gown with deco-inspired lines, delicate flutter sleeves and a stunning deep V-back is another fantastic choice for a smaller celebration. Brides wanting a plunging neckline will love the Shooting Star evening gown that also features dramatic bishop sleeves and rhinestone details on the shoulders. “For a touch of Hollywood glamour, our silk velvet evening gown Ophelia is an alternative option for a low-key affair, while Elenor , also from the evening collection, also suits micro weddings with its luxurious silk velvet fabric and oversized bow and deep cowl back,” Lynsey describes. Lynsey has also designed a collection of bridal face coverings crafted from sumptuous fabrics including lace with hand-sewn appliqué and beadwork.
